Ending Friday September 14, 2012:

  • as per Bankrates.com, the highest one year CD yield available is 1.1%
  • as per FINRA/Bloomberg, the Investment Grade U.S. Corporate Bond index yields 3.39%
  • as per Yahoo Finance, S&P growth excluding dividends over the previous one year period was 23.3%
    • S&P Price 9/14/2011….1188.68
    • S&P Price 9/14/2012….1465.77
